AAAS fellows comprise an illustrious group of scientists such as inventor Thomas Edison, anthropologist Margaret Mead and biologist James Watson.<\/p>\n<p>The 2017 AAAS Fellows also will be announced in the AAAS News &amp; Notes section of the November 24, 2017, issue of\u00a0<em>Science <\/em>magazine<em>.\u00a0<\/em>Hacker and other 2017 AAAS fellows will be recognized at the 2018 AAAS annual meeting in Austin, Texas, February 15\u201319, 2018.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Studying the value of marine ecosystems<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>As a community ecologist, Hacker has studied the coastal habitats of estuaries, dunes, sandy beaches and rocky shore communities for more than two decades. She is an expert on the role and influence of native and non-native plant species in the Pacific Northwest coast, their ecological consequences and how they modify and transform communities through biophysical interactions with the coastal ecosystem.<\/p>\n<p>Her studies on the effects of non-native beach grasses\u2014transplanted from Europe and the East Coast of the United States to the sand dunes of the Pacific Northwest a century ago\u2014upon coastal dune ecosystems has led to important discoveries about their role in biodiversity, dune formation through sand capture, and the coastal protection as barriers against storms and floods. Sandy beaches and dunes not only provide important recreational opportunities but also offset the harmful effects of sea level rise and increased storminess.<\/p>\n<blockquote><p>\u201cThe reason why I think dunes and their vegetation are so interesting is because of their large bioengineering effect on the environment. The grasses help to build a protective ecosystem\u2014to me it is fascinating that you can have an organism that is creating a habitat and protective structure with immense environmental and human benefits,\u201d said Hacker, who joined OSU\u2019s College of Science faculty in 2004.<\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p>Hacker\u2019s research has gained renown for her distinctive approach in raising awareness about the incredible value of coastal ecosystems and advocating for their management and conservation. Her research probes the effects of climate change on such habitats and the implications for commercial fisheries.<\/p>\n<p>With the help of multiple grants from the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A), including Oregon Sea Grant and National Centers for Coastal Ocean Science (NCCOS), Hacker investigates critically important aspects of coastal ecosystems and their protection.<\/p>\n<p>An ongoing Oregon Sea Grant study by Hacker, Francis Chan (Integrative Biology) and Peter Ruggiero (College of Earth, Ocean and Atmospheric Sciences) examines the relationship between ocean productivity and dune ecosystem function as well as dune coastal protection and conservation services. Another study considers the impact of sea level rise on natural and managed beaches and dunes in the vulnerable coastal areas of North Carolina.<\/p>\n<p>In an exciting multidisciplinary collaboration funded by an award from NOAA NCCOS, Hacker, OSU coastal engineers and applied economists are exploring the valuation of natural ecosystem services.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cMarine ecosystems have value that go beyond ordinary measures. They protect life, property and infrastructure against storms and even tsunamis, provide recreation and contribute to environmental and human well-being,\u201d said Hacker.<\/p>\n<p>Using scientifically rigorous methods, Hacker and her collaborators are attempting to truly recognize and publicize the economic services and value of diverse marine ecosystems to the public and to policymakers.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We are trying to understand and make visible the dollar value of a range of ecosystem services from the local to landscape scales.
